Index of turnover in industry 2026, March
Turnover in industry grew by 5.6 per cent in March 2026
releaseAccording to Statistics Finland, working day adjusted turnover in industry (TOL BCD) increased by 5.6 per cent in March 2026 from March 2025.

Turnover grew most in the chemical industry
Working day adjusted turnover increased most in March in the chemical industry, by 36.8 per cent from the previous year. Turnover in mining and quarrying was 21.2 per cent higher than one year earlier. Turnover in the food industry increased by 9.8 per cent and that in the metal industry by 2.1 per cent from one year before.
Turnover was 8.8 per cent lower in the electronic and electrical industry in March than one year ago. Turnover in the forest industry declined by 8.5 per cent. Turnover decreased by 3.3 per cent from one year ago in both electricity, gas, steam and air conditioning supply and the textile, clothing and leather industry.
Export turnover grew most in mining and quarrying
In March, export turnover grew most in mining and quarrying, up by 46.0 per cent from the previous year. Export turnover grew strongly also in the chemical industry, by 39.0 per cent from the year before. Export turnover in the food industry was 5.2 per cent higher than one year before. Export turnover decreased most in the forest industry, by 12.2 per cent from one year ago. Export turnover was lower than one year before also in the electronic and electrical industry (-11.5%), the textile, clothing and leather industry (-6.9%) and the metal industry (-0.4%).
Domestic turnover increased most in March in the chemical industry, by 28.7 per cent from the previous year. Domestic turnover in the electronic and electrical industry was 20.4 per cent higher than in the previous year. Domestic turnover also went up in the metal industry (11.3%), the food industry (10.7%) and the forest industry (1.6%). Domestic turnover decreased in mining and quarrying (-4.8%) and in the textile, clothing and leather industry (-0.3%).
Turnover decreased in March from the previous month
Seasonally adjusted turnover in industry decreased slightly, by 0.1 per cent, in March 2026 compared to February. In February, turnover increased by 3.0 per cent and in January by 4.4 per cent from the month before.
